How to format an ACS reference list?
Formatting Your Reference List The reference list should appear at the end of your paper. The title References should be left justified. The entries should appear as one numerical sequence in the order that the material is cited in the text of your assignment. The entire section is single-spaced.

Should ACS references be in alphabetical order?
Basics. The bibliography, or reference list, appears at the end of the paper in alphabetical order if cited by author and date or in numerical order if cited by numbers. Different reference formats (book vs journal vs website) have different rules for citation.

What is ASC style?
Superscript numbers: These numbers will appear small and outside the punctuation of the sentence. 1. Italic numbers: These will go inside parenthesis and before the punctuation ending the sentence (2). Author name and year: These will be inside parenthesis and before the punctuation mark (King et al., 2018).
How are references listed in ACS?
Ordering the References List. If you used numerical (parenthetical or superscript) in-text citations, put your references in numerical order. If you used author-date in-text citations, order references in alphabetical order by last name of the first author. Keep in mind that "nothing precedes something."
What is the format for ACS books?
Basic format: Author(s). Chapter Title. In Book Title [Online]; Editor(s), Eds.; Publisher: Place of Publication, Year, Pages.
